Radhika Jeweltech Ltd’s stock declined to a fresh 52-week low of Rs.59.42 today, marking a significant downturn amid a five-day losing streak that has eroded over 10% of its value. This decline contrasts with the broader market’s positive momentum, underscoring ongoing challenges faced by the company within the Gems, Jewellery and Watches sector.
Radhika Jeweltech Ltd Stock Hits 52-Week Low Amidst Continued Downtrend

Stock Price Movement and Market Context

On 5 Mar 2026, Radhika Jeweltech Ltd’s share price touched Rs.59.42, its lowest level in the past year. The stock has underperformed its sector, falling by 0.73% today and lagging the Gems, Jewellery and Watches sector by 0.86%. Over the last five trading sessions, the stock has recorded a cumulative loss of 10.36%, reflecting sustained downward pressure. This decline is notable given the broader market environment, where the Sensex opened 414.29 points higher and was trading at 79,583.92, up 0.59%.

Despite the Sensex’s positive trajectory, led by mega-cap stocks, Radhika Jeweltech’s shares remain below all key moving averages — including the 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day averages — signalling persistent bearish sentiment among traders.

Comparative Performance Over One Year

Over the past 12 months, Radhika Jeweltech Ltd’s stock has declined by 30.59%, a stark contrast to the Sensex’s gain of 7.96% and the BSE500 index’s 10.85% rise. The stock’s 52-week high was Rs.111.48, indicating a near 47% drop from its peak. This underperformance highlights the company’s relative weakness within the broader market and its sector peers.

Financial Metrics and Profitability

Despite the stock’s price weakness, Radhika Jeweltech Ltd has reported positive financial results in recent quarters. The company declared its highest quarterly net sales at Rs.213.59 crores and recorded a PBDIT of Rs.41.78 crores, also the highest for the period. Its profit after tax (PAT) for the first nine months stands at Rs.67.26 crores, reflecting a 35.5% increase in profits over the past year.

The company maintains a low average debt-to-equity ratio of 0.10 times, indicating a conservative capital structure with limited leverage.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) is reported at 24.3%, underscoring efficient utilisation of capital. The enterprise value to capital employed ratio is 2.1, suggesting an attractive valuation relative to the company’s asset base.

Valuation and Peer Comparison

Radhika Jeweltech Ltd is currently trading at a discount compared to its peers’ average historical valuations. The company’s PEG ratio stands at 0.3, which is relatively low and indicates that the stock price has not fully reflected the recent profit growth. However, this valuation discount has not translated into positive price momentum, as the stock continues to face downward pressure.
